Description

Civil Subpoena: This is an Official California form, which states that the person served is demanded to appear at a hearing, or trial, for this civil suit. It lists the date and time of the hearing, or trial, and informs that there are penalties for not appearing. This form is available in both Word and PDF formats.

There are valid reasons to seek relief from an El Monte California Civil Subpoena for Personal Appearance at Trial or Hearing. For instance, you might have a scheduling conflict, medical issues, or privilege concerns. However, it's crucial to formally file for a motion to quash the subpoena in court, where a legal authority will evaluate your reasons and make a determination.

The most appropriate response to an El Monte California Civil Subpoena for Personal Appearance at Trial or Hearing is to comply with the instructions provided in the subpoena. Ignoring the subpoena can lead to legal consequences, including fines or contempt of court charges. Therefore, ensure you understand the requirements and gather the necessary information or documents requested.

A civil subpoena for personal appearance at trial or hearing requires a witness to attend court and provide testimony relevant to a case. This type of subpoena is crucial for presenting firsthand accounts that can influence court decisions.
